Description We already keep the sector in the radix tree as part of the exceptional entry. For page faults where we already have an exceptional entry, use this information directly from the radix tree instead of calling into the filesystem to get a block mapping. This should show a measurable performance improvement, which should be reported as motivation for the patches.
